Transaction 907f64b946d41baf73ff651702dc91af36ebca207aaf61cc6aecf1c87cdfa693

1 Input
2 Outputs
  • 907f64b946d41baf73ff651702dc91af36ebca207aaf61cc6aecf1c87cdfa693:0
  • value  10000
    address  38uYndMai8gnUwZNGBaMgnjeVke2qwVDsG
  • 907f64b946d41baf73ff651702dc91af36ebca207aaf61cc6aecf1c87cdfa693:1
  • value  3409417
    address  1FTyaAubDkkePZCC7CggxetfaCHYKoCJ1J